This document, Digital Video Minimum Performance Specifications, Ver. 14, was created to provide law enforcement agencies and system manufacturers with a set of recommended minimum performance system specifications in order to yield evidentiary-quality digital recordings and promote officer safety. Currently no testing or certification program exists to independently verify any product’s compliance with the specifications.

The IACP, under cooperative agreement with the Department of Justice, National Institute of Justice (NIJ), is currently facilitating the development of a technical standard for Vehicular Digital Multimedia Evidence Recording Systems (VDMERS). This NIJ standard is based in part on the Digital Video Minimum Performance Specifications document developed by the IACP and is expected to be completed by the end of 2010. A certification program document is also being developed concurrently by NIJ in conjunction with this standard.
